Harry Wlilte and Associates Prepare to Spend $40,000,660 to Con struct 5000 Miles of Road. IiOS ANGELES, Xov. 3. The Evening ExprcsL says: Alaska -will have a railway Its entire length from north to south and giving communication with the outside world, It plans which are being formulated In this city are carried out. Harry "White, formerly ilayor of Seattle, Is at the head Of the enterprise, which Includes an ap plication to Congress during the coming session for a Government subsidy. The Idea, as outlined, is for the Government to guarantee the bonds of the proposed company, which Is yet to be organized for the purpose, the promoters using the credit thus obtained - to raise the funds for building the line. It Is exected that Senator Samuel H. Piles, of Washington, will father the scheme in Congress. If successful, the enterprise will in volve an expenditure of about J4O.O0O.000. The road will be nearly 6000 miles In length. NORTH COAST IS INDEPENDENT Director Snys New Road Has Back ing That Can Fight Harrlman. NORTH YAKIMA. Wash., Nov. 2. (Special.) O. A. Fechter. one of the di rectors of the North Coast Railway, said today: "The North Coast is absolutely inde pendent of all other railways- So far there have been no stops taken to "con nect with any of the other systems. " e are no more connected with the Chicago, Milwaukee & St. Paul than the farmers of the valley. The men of the North Coast are able to finance the road for a new transcontinental line If they wish, and their standing is such that neither Harrlman nor the Northern Pacific can lceep them from accomplishing, the work. It they see fit to take it up. You might know we arc not of the Harrlman party from the fact that we are working through Walla "Walla and the Blue Mountains, and If we were go ing to connect with the Union Pacific we could make a much closer connection than by that route. It may be that later on the North Coast will Join the Gould system, but at the present time there is no connection between the two. It may fco that the North Coast will be an en tirely new system across the continent. Tout It Is more than likely that we will con nect with one of the existing systems." In view of .he fact that the Gould sys tem, the Northwestern, has been com pleted as far west as the Eastern line of Idaho, and the further fact that sur veyors are at work in the Blue Moun tains east of Walla Walla, the North Coast may bo a part of this system. There has' been no new developments in Yakima since the first of the week. Extra forces of men have, been put to working grading along the Nachez Val ley and a corps of surveyors is working between here and Sunnyslde. The com pany Is still purchasing small tracts of land In and near this city preparatory to building the roundhouse, station and( car shops. There Is a great shortage of cars on the Northern Pacific in the Yakima Val ley, Farmers cannot get rid of their products. The demand fgr Yakima hay and potatoes is very large, but shipments are light. The company has taken care of the fruit shipments to Eastern points, "out has cut out Western shipments of any sire except by local freight and express. The Iiaw Protects Mr. Laws. ASTORIA, Or., Nov. 3. (Special.) At St Helens yesterday afternoon Judge Mc Brlde issued a writ of mandamus as prayed for in the suit filed here yesterday morning by W. C Laws vs. Olof Ander son, Auditor and Police Judge for, the City of Astoria. A copy of the writ was Berved on the Auditor today. It com mands him to print Mr. Laws' name on the Republican primary election ticket and also commands the Auditor that If Mr Laws is nominated at the primaries as a candidate for 'Police Commissioner, to print his name on the ballot for the city election. ' More Water for Ccntralla. CENTRALIA. Wash., Nov. 3. The Cen tralla Water Company has an engineer In Ccntralla and Is planning extensive im provements. Harvey L. Johnson, presi dent of the company, states active work of bettering the system will be com menced at once. The company desires, "ho says, to put In a gravity system, but the cost makes this impracticable. Work of reconstruction will be commenced when the engineer reports. A well system will be established. A new steam pump will be put In, and the reservoir on the hill enlarged again. Boys Will Build Gymnasium. CENTRALIA. Wash., Nov. 3. The Cen tralla High School Athletic Association pas plans under way to build a gymnasium this Winter. The School Board has sig nified Its willingness to give the boys ground. It is the intention to start the hulldlng, and let succeeding classes com plete It. The Centralia School Board also has calls out for bids on two new school rooms.
